GFP mocks at govt for keeping on hold Lohia Maidan revamp

MARGAO: Goa Forward Party (GFP) chief Vijai Sardesai has mocked the Government for sending back works due to a lack of funds. He has also flayed the Government for only making statements and not fulfilling the assurances. 
Vijai complained that the work of Lohia Maidan revamp has been sent back due to a lack of funds.
“”No funds for Lohia maidan is the biggest insult to Lohia and his legacy for Goa. We are warning the Government to clear the file worth Rs 3.25 crore before December 19. Finance is replying that there is no money. We will have to look at other ways to protest,” Vijai warned.
“The government has Rs 16 crore to spend for IFFI and not for Lohia Maidan,” Vijai quipped.
He accused the government of going very slow on the Bio-methanation plant proposals. “I hope that the file is cleared soon which will help the removal of black spots from Margao Municipal areas,” Vijai said. 
Criticizing the government for giving an assurance of a direct flight from London to Goa, Vijai said, “Many OCI people who are in news now are coming back to Goa for the Christmas celebrations. However, the tickets are costly and have doubled in fact this season. There was an announcement of the direct flight from London to Goa, but there is no sign of flight and it’s just a statement.”
